Transaction 20564dfec714055ee23ec1201b7c599efb6012abf179f4bfcc79b8c5f069e812

1 Input
2 Outputs
  • 20564dfec714055ee23ec1201b7c599efb6012abf179f4bfcc79b8c5f069e812:0
  • value  492275
    address  36p1hkbGRtAYL2De9uDCMtYhe9De9b8eYS
  • 20564dfec714055ee23ec1201b7c599efb6012abf179f4bfcc79b8c5f069e812:1
  • value  65368134
    address  3BAneLYz9DNokjqdCtrXV7fBou7AWXEhyX